The law library at the University of Zurich, home to over 230,000 books and 500 specialist journals, has been completely modernized as part of a comprehensive lighting refurbishment.
With the integration of TWILINE building automation - Swiss Made, the university is setting new standards in energy efficiency, comfort and sustainability.

šŸ’” Intelligent lighting control - zone-by-zone and demand-oriented

The modernization included all lighting zones in the library:
Reading areas, corridors, bookshelves, seminar rooms, cafeteria and the impressive dome lighting were equipped with the latest TWILINE technology.
This means that light is only generated where and when it is needed - automatically, precisely and energy-efficiently.

Integrated areas:

  • Reading areas with optimum workplace lighting

  • Corridors and shelving zones with dynamic presence control

  • Architectural dome lighting with automatic daylight adjustment

  • Cafeteria, seminar rooms and outdoor lighting - centrally integrated and controlled

āš™ļø Technology that thinks for itself - orchestrated by TWILINE

TWILINE building automation controls the entire lighting system via a finely networked system with more than 4,000 data points.
All lighting zones are intelligently linked, monitored and controlled in real time via 17 central units - for maximum efficiency and transparency.

Functional highlights:

  • Automatic brightness control according to daylight and opening hours

  • Presence-dependent control in corridors and ancillary areas

  • Real-time monitoring and data analysis for energy-optimized operation

  • Integration into the higher-level control system: switching times, light OFF commands and fault messages

  • Central parameterization and visualization for easy operation
